Question or Answer
1. What is the best time of year to visit Japan?
The best time to visit Japan is during the spring (March to May) or fall (September to November) when the weather is mild and the scenery is beautiful.
2. Is it easy to get around Japan without speaking Japanese?
Yes, it's relatively easy to get around Japan without speaking Japanese. Most signs and maps are in both Japanese and English, and many locals speak at least some English.
3. What is the currency used in Japan?
The currency used in Japan is the yen.
4. Do I need a visa to visit Japan?
It depends on your country of origin. Citizens from some countries can enter Japan without a visa for a certain period, while others need to apply for a visa before their trip.
